Output 2a8146c533317abfd45c8965ccd3264f51a57527ef09137defa16cc230346f33:2

value
60819000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89103de817213f9d5d2ea1fbeed923a48d26313e OP_EQUAL
address
3EBjxKsQJntFHqg22kMFVK3mtiLjA3bCSm
transaction
2a8146c533317abfd45c8965ccd3264f51a57527ef09137defa16cc230346f33
confirmations
423947
spent
true